| Career Role (Ulcerative Colitis Nutritional Therapies) | Description |
|---|---|
| Registered Dietitian (RD) specializing in IBD | Provides expert nutritional guidance and support to patients with ulcerative colitis, managing dietary intake and optimizing treatment plans. High demand due to rising prevalence of IBD. |
| Specialist IBD Nurse | Works collaboratively with RDs and gastroenterologists. Focuses on holistic patient care, encompassing nutritional advice alongside medication management and disease monitoring. Significant skill demand in the UK. |
| Nutritional Therapist (Ulcerative Colitis Focus) | Offers personalized nutritional plans, often working independently or alongside medical professionals. Growing job market as awareness of dietary impact on IBD increases. |
| Research Dietitian (IBD) | Conducts research on the role of nutrition in ulcerative colitis management and treatment. High-level specialized role requiring advanced degrees and research experience. |
